Chia‐Yu Chang is a scholar working on Molecular Biology, Epidemiology and Physiology. According to data from OpenAlex, Chia‐Yu Chang has authored 71 papers receiving a total of 1.8k ind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Molecular Biology, 12 papers in Epidemiology and 11 papers in Physiology. Recurrent topics in Chia‐Yu Chang’s work include Herpesvirus Infections and Treatments (6 papers), Vitamin C and Antioxidants Research (5 papers) and Acne and Rosacea Treatments and Effects (4 papers). Chia‐Yu Chang is often cited by papers focused on Herpesvirus Infections and Treatments (6 papers), Vitamin C and Antioxidants Research (5 papers) and Acne and Rosacea Treatments and Effects (4 papers). Chia‐Yu Chang collaborates with scholars based in Taiwan, United States and Japan. Chia‐Yu Chang's co-authors include Jen‐Yin Chen, Miao‐Lin Hu, Der-Shin Ke, Tain-Junn Cheng, Shu-Lan Yeh, Tain‐Junn Cheng, Jiunn‐Jye Chuu, Shinn‐Zong Lin, Hong-Lin Su and How‐Ran Guo and has published in prestigious journals such as Journal of Biological Chemistry, PLoS ONE and Stroke.
